In celebration of the 40th anniversary of the Poetry Center at Passaic County Community College, there will be a ceremony and reception in the parlor on the first floor of the Hamilton Club Building on February 1, 2020, beginning at 11:30 a.m.

The Poetry Center, founded in 1980 by award-winning poet, Maria Mazziotti Gillan, its executive director, has hosted thousands of poets over the years at readings, workshops and conferences. These include poet laureates, Pulitzer Prize winners, and others of national and international reputation, such as Allen Ginsberg, Amiri Baraka, Lucille Clifton, Stanley Kunitz, Gerald Stern, William Stafford, Martin Espada, and Marge Piercy.
